Study Summary

This is an Early Feasibility Study to evaluate the usability, safety and functionality of 3D holographic guidance, navigation, and control (3D-GNC) as an adjunct to and confirmed by fluoroscopic imaging to be used with Cook Zenith Flex AAA Endovascular Graft.

Primary Outcome

Number of Patients with Correct positioning of the endovascular stent graft using the 3D-GN\&C device confirmed by fluoroscopic imaging
